A number of towns and cities across Vermont have implemented burn bans as the fire danger was high to very high statewide. Some of those communities were Montpelier, St. Johnsbury, Chester, and Stowe.
The Vermont Department of Forests, Parks, and Recreation has issued an order for all of the state’s forest fire wardens to cease issuing burning permits until further notice, according to the Town of Wallingford.
The Town of Essex was not issuing burn permits due to the dry conditions and absence of rain in the forecast.
